apply a new version to the current package
yarn version <strategy>Examples
Section titled “Examples”Immediately bump the version to the next major :
yarn version majorPrepare the version to be bumped to the next major :
yarn version major --deferredDetails
Section titled “Details”This command will bump the version number for the given package, following the specified strategy:
-
If
major, the first number from the semver range will be increased (X.0.0). -
If
minor, the second number from the semver range will be increased (0.X.0). -
If
patch, the third number from the semver range will be increased (0.0.X). -
If prefixed by
pre(premajor, …), a-0suffix will be set (0.0.0-0). -
If
prerelease, the suffix will be increased (0.0.0-X); the third number from the semver range will also be increased if there was no suffix in the previous version. -
If
decline, the nonce will be increased foryarn version checkto pass without version bump. -
If a valid semver range, it will be used as new version.
-
If unspecified, Yarn will ask you for guidance.
